Quick Mountain Facts:
- Established: 1958
- Base Elevation: 2,997 Feet
- Top Elevation: 3,600 Feet
- Vertical Drop: 603 Feet
- Skiable Acres: 90+ Acres
- Snowmaking: 100% based on weather
- Longest Run: 1 1/4 Mile (Intermediate Trail โ Panorama)
- Number of Trails: 28 Slopes and two Terrain Park
- Slope Difficulty: Easiest โ 40%; Intermediate โ 35%; Advanced โ 25%
- Total Lifts: Nine Lifts (Two Quads, Two Doubles, Three Triples, and Two Carpet Lifts)
- Night Skiing: Night Skiing is available on 26 slopes
- Snow Tubing Park: Largest Snow Tubing Park in WV with Two Carpet Lifts and up to 14 Lanes
- Snow Tubing Height: Children must be at least 44 inches or taller to snow tube.
- Annual Snowfall: 100 inches
Winterplace prides itself on its fully automated snowmaking capabilities covering all its terrain. The resort receives 100 inches of annual snowfall, which gives it solid conditions for its snowmaking abilities. MARCH EVENTS
Snowmelt Festival Weekend: Saturday, March 1 through Sunday, March 2
Winterplace invites families to celebrate March on the slopes with a weekend of traditional ski and board entertainment for all ages. The highly anticipated return of the Pond Skim and the Cardboard Classic sled race offer exciting prizes. Participation in the Cardboard Classic Race and the Pond Skim Race is free with a lift ticket. The weekend will also include live entertainment and food trucks.
Cardboard Classic Race: Saturday, March 1, Starts at 2 p.m.
The Cardboard Classic Sled Race takes place in the Snowtubing Park. Registration is free, and participants can sign up at the Mountain House from 11 a.m. to 1:30 p.m. Teams of two are invited to build their sled using only cardboard, tape, glue, and duct tape. Decorations such as paint and stickers are permitted, but no metal or plastic additions are allowed on the sledโs bottom. No lift ticket is required for this event. Winterplace will organize guests into heats or categories, with the first-place winners in each category receiving prizes. Each team will launch from the top of the snow-tubing park to see who can go the farthest and the fastest. Family and friends are invited to gather for a viewing party. Winners will be announced at 4:30 p.m.
Pond Skim Race: Sunday, March 2, Starts at 2 p.m.
Winterplace is bringing back its favorite Pond Skim event. Skiers and snowboarders are encouraged to show off their skills by crossing the pond in their best costumes. The challenge is to skim across the pond from the lowest point on the mountain.
